I have two MMM hens, the larger of the duo started laying on the 23rd (couple days before they turned 18 weeks) and the other followed suit the next day. The first hen, Jesse, has laid every single day (8 days at this point); 3 of hers eggs ended up having double yolks as well! The smaller has only laid one, though. Wasn't expecting so many eggs as it's winter here now

I have 4, 1 cockerel and 3 pullets. They are 4 months old right now. From what I have been able to find in my searches I believe they are a sex link cross between a Black Copper Marans Rooster and a Cuckoo Marans Hen. From my experience they are fast growing and large size birds. My cockerel started crowing at 3 1/2 months old and is chasing around the ladies at 4 months old, although he hasn't figured out how to catch one yet! They also get along well with my other breeds in my mixed flock. Here are a few pictures.View attachment 1926979 View attachment 1926980 View attachment 1926981
